#c59847 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c59847 is composed of 77.3% red, 59.6%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.8% magenta, 64%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 38.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.1% and a lightness of 52.5%. #c59847 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8e with #8b3100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#c59847 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c59847 has RGB values of R:197, G:152,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.64,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12949575.

Shades and Tints of #c59847

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0703 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#c59847

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d887f is the less saturated color, while #fda80f is the most saturated one.
